Just a quick note to say that the Linux User Group of Cremona -
Italy, is promoting a recording session with UbuntuStudio in a live
music pub here in Cremona for Sunday, April 17.

We will record the performance of a local rock band and will
demonstrate US in particular and Linux for audio production in
general.

Following the featured band performance, there will be an open jam
session with numerous bands and single musicians involved - US will
provide backing tracks and the like.

We are also printing an eight page booklet with introductory info
about US; this booklet will be made available to the public.
